That’s the message Brooklyn Borough President Eric Adams sent in response to the profanity that Toronto Raptors general manager Masai Ujiri heaved in the direction of New York City’s most populous borough.
During a pregame address meant to pump up a group of fans outside Toronto’s Air Canada Centre before Game 1 of the teams’ playoff series, Ujiri said, “F— Brooklyn.”
In a needling statement released later Saturday, Adams said: “It’s unfortunate that the Raptors’ GM felt desperate facing our Nets that he would throw profanity around discussing our beloved borough, but I can’t say I’m surprised. After all, Brooklyn is a classier place. Just compare Babs (Barbra Streisand) to Biebs (Justin Bieber), or spend some time with their…colorful mayor. Still, we spread love; it is, after all, the Brooklyn way.”
